Bonus Strategy
Bonuses can boost your bankroll significantly, but understanding the math is crucial. Most offers require a 888 casino bonus code to activate. Below is a typical calculation using a 100% match bonus up to $100 with a 30x wagering requirement on the deposit plus bonus.
Example: You deposit $50 and receive a $50 bonus. Your total balance is $100. Wagering requirement = ($50 + $50) × 30 = $3,000. If you play only slots (100% contribution), you must wager $3,000 before withdrawing any winnings from the bonus.
| Game Type | Contribution Percentage | Example Wagering Needed |
|---|---|---|
| Slots | 100% | $3,000 |
| Table Games (Blackjack, Roulette) | 10-20% | $15,000-$30,000 |
| Video Poker | 50% | $6,000 |
Always check the terms for max bet limits and game restrictions. Using 888 casino bonus codes correctly can give you a head start, but never wager more than you can afford.
FAQ
What documents are needed for verification?
You will typically need a copy of your passport or driver’s license, plus a recent utility bill or bank statement showing your name and address.
How long do withdrawals take?
Processing times vary by method: e-wallets often take 24-48 hours, while bank transfers may take 3-5 business days. The first withdrawal may take longer due to initial verification.
Are there wagering requirements on all bonuses?
Yes, most bonuses come with wagering requirements. Free spins usually have their own terms, and deposit matches require a set multiplier on the bonus amount before withdrawal.
Can I set deposit limits?
Absolutely. In your account settings, you can set daily, weekly, or monthly deposit limits to manage your spending responsibly.
Insider Advice
Responsible gambling tools are your safety net. Besides deposit limits, you can set session time reminders (e.g., alerts every 30 minutes) and take a break with cool-off periods. For complete control, self-exclusion allows you to block your account for months or years. These features are available in the responsible gambling section of your profile. Use them proactively to keep gaming fun and within your means.
